Sign-O-Pedia: Wander Bertoni

About the tag

Sculptor

Born in Codisotto (Reggio Emilia), Italy (1925-2019)
Austrian sculptor considered one of the pioneers of abstract sculpture in Austria after World War II. He arrived in Vienna as a forced laborer from Italy during the war, stayed there and became one of the most influential artists in the city (and even served as a professor at the University of Applied Arts).
As a sculptor, he initially worked on restoring statues and monuments damaged in the war (including the Plague Column ), and later on his abstract sculptures.
